"The Seventh Floor" is a captivating novel by bestselling author David McCloskey, known for his work "Damascus Station" and as a co-host of the successful podcast "The Rest is Classified." In this thrilling crime and mystery novel, McCloskey takes readers on an engaging journey characterized by its complex plot and profound characters. With a page count of 400 and a weight of 584 grams, the book offers a comprehensive reading experience that is both entertaining and challenging. The narrative is written in English and targets a broad audience interested in fiction. The book's dimensions are 24.2 cm in height and 16.1 cm in width, making it a handy companion for avid readers. McCloskey's ability to weave tension and intrigue promises an unforgettable reading experience that will appeal to both genre fans and new readers alike.
